Securities Transaction Tax (STT):
STT is levied on stocks and equity mutual funds in lieu of tax-free dividends and also lower capital gain taxes. Equity mutual funds are defined as schemes that maintain more than 65 percent equity exposure and because of that, equity oriented balance funds and arbitrage funds also comes under this category.
Indexation Benefit:
While computing long-term capital gain (LTCG), indexation benefit is provided as compensation against inflation. For example, if the LTCG is 10 percent per annum and the inflation is 7 percent per annum, you need to pay tax only on 3 percent additional gains. Indexation benefit is not available for instruments that have interest components.
